LL63 ODX is a 2013 Toyota Prius Plus in Grey with a 1,798cc hybrid electric (clean) engine. This vehicle has been through 33 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.
Across all 2013 Toyota Prius Plus models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.6% with a typical mileage of 111,237 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Prius Plus f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 58 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LL63 ODX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Prius Plus typically stays on UK roads for around 15 years. At 13 years old, this Toyota Prius Plus is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
